Practical Tips for Communicating With Your Pet

Successful communication with pets can significantly enhance the bond between them and their owners. To foster this connection, owners should monitor their pet's body language and vocalizations. Different positions of the ears, tail movements, and facial expressions can convey a spectrum of emotions. Furthermore, maintaining eye contact can help build trust and understanding.

Using uniform commands and positive reinforcement is vital; this creates a clear communication line. Owners should also ensure they listen, as pets often communicate their feelings through actions as opposed to copyright. Taking part in playtime or quiet moments can strengthen the emotional relationship, enabling a more intuitive understanding of each other's needs.

Lastly, being patient and empathetic is essential. Acknowledging that animals have their own individual temperaments and feelings will strengthen communication, leading to a more balanced bond. By applying these practical tips, owners can greatly improve their communication with their treasured animals.
